The fire is out. The walls are repainted. But weeks later, every time the air-conditioning kicks in, the smell comes back. If you have lived through a kitchen fire, an electrical fault, or even a neighbour's incident that sent smoke through a shared corridor, you will know this feeling precisely.
Smoke odour is not just a surface problem. Char particles and volatile organic compounds (VOCs) penetrate carpet pile, sofa cushions, curtain fabric and mattress padding within minutes of exposure. Once they bond to fibres at a molecular level, airing the room and wiping down hard surfaces does very little. The smell stays because the contamination stays.

Why smoke odour bonds so stubbornly to soft furnishings
The chemistry in plain terms
When something burns, it releases two kinds of residue: visible soot (fine char particles) and invisible VOCs, gases that include formaldehyde, benzene and acrolein. Both travel on air currents and settle across every porous surface in the room within minutes. Hard surfaces like tiles and painted walls can be wiped; soft furnishings absorb.
Carpet pile acts like a dense filter, trapping char particles between fibres at depths a vacuum cannot reach. Upholstery foam and curtain weave do the same. The VOCs go further still, chemically bonding with the proteins and natural oils in wool, cotton and other organic fibres. This is why a synthetic-fibre rug and a wool rug sitting side by side will both smell after a fire, but the wool rug will hold the odour far longer.
Secondary smoke transfer
Smoke does not only travel from the source. In a condo or HDB flat, smoke can migrate through air-conditioning ducting, gaps under doors and shared ventilation shafts. Soft furnishings in a room that was never directly exposed can still absorb enough residue to develop a persistent smell. This is sometimes called secondary smoke transfer, and it catches many homeowners off guard, they clean the affected room thoroughly and cannot understand why the living room sofa still smells two months later.
What DIY cleaning can and cannot do
What you can shift yourself
Immediate action in the first hours does matter. Opening windows and running an air purifier with a HEPA and activated-carbon filter will reduce the concentration of airborne VOCs before they fully settle. Blotting visible soot from upholstery with a dry cloth (never rubbing, rubbing drives particles deeper) removes some of the surface load. Vacuuming carpet and curtains with a strong suction attachment lifts loose char from the top of the pile.
For hard surfaces in the affected area, tiles, grout, bathroom floors near the kitchen, a thorough scrub helps contain the spread. For lightly affected rooms where secondary transfer was minimal, airing plus vacuuming may be enough to reduce the smell to a barely noticeable level over several weeks.
What DIY cannot do
Beyond surface soot, DIY methods run out of reach. Domestic vacuums do not generate the suction or depth of penetration to pull char particles from the mid-pile or the backing of a carpet. Baking soda and bicarbonate products neutralise some odour molecules at the surface but cannot reach the residue bonded to fibres below. Spray-on odour eliminators mask the smell temporarily; as the fragrance fades, the underlying VOCs continue off-gassing.
Over-wetting soft furnishings with DIY cleaning solutions also creates a second problem: mould. In Singapore's humidity, a sofa cushion or carpet that stays damp for more than a day is at real risk of developing mould growth in the padding, compounding the original problem. Hot-water extraction versus dry-cleaning encapsulation: choosing the right method
Not all soft furnishings respond to the same treatment, and choosing the wrong method risks damaging the fabric or driving residue further in.

For most residential smoke damage, professional carpet cleaning using hot-water extraction is the correct starting point for synthetic and mixed-fibre carpets. The high temperature (typically above 70°C) breaks the bond between VOC molecules and synthetic fibres, and the simultaneous extraction removes both the residue and the water, leaving no chemical trace and reducing the re-soiling risk.
For wool rugs, antique Persian or Oriental pieces, or delicate upholstery, dry-cleaning encapsulation is safer. Curtains warrant their own treatment. Drapery fabric traps smoke along the entire length, and washing at home risks shrinkage and permanent creasing. The realistic timeline for odour clearance
A single professional clean on all affected soft furnishings, carpet, sofa, curtains and mattress, will clear the odour substantially in most cases. Dry-to-touch time after hot-water extraction is typically 4–6 hours, so rooms are usable the same day.
For heavy smoke loads from a serious fire, a second treatment may be needed two to three weeks after the first, once the fibres have had time to release deeper-set residue (this is a known phenomenon called wicking, where moisture movement draws embedded particles back toward the surface as the fabric dries). The cases where odour cannot be fully cleared are real and worth stating plainly. Carpet or upholstery that was directly exposed to flames, or that has been left untreated for several months, may have char damage to the fibre structure itself. When the fibre is physically altered by heat, no amount of cleaning restores it, the odour source is the damaged fibre, not just deposited residue. Is hot-water extraction safe for all rugs and carpets?
Not for all fibres. Hot-water extraction is well-suited to synthetic pile (nylon, polypropylene) and most cotton blends. Wool rugs, silk pieces and hand-knotted antiques need a fibre assessment first, the wrong temperature or pressure can cause irreversible shrinkage or colour bleed.
